Anisidine value test is used to assess the secondary oxidation of oil or fat, which is mainly imputable to aldehydes and ketones, and is therefore able to tell the oxidation “history” of an oil or a fat.
Furthermore, AnV analysis on oil is an indicator of excessive oil deterioration in deep frying process.
